Skihist Provincial Park is situated above the Thompson River on Highway 1, 6km east of Lytton. The park was established in 1956 mainly to provide overnight accommodation for travellers on Highway 1. The lush green lawns of Skihist have always invited travellers to stop and relax from the heat of the summer. The park preserves a section of the historic Cariboo Wagon road. Additional Info: 58 campsites (54 RV-accessible up to 32 ft, 4 tent-only), first-come first-served, pet-friendly, with picnic tables, fire pits, pit/flush toilets, water taps, garbage stations, sani-station, and wood corral. No RV hookups. Open summer season.
